TEXT 49
- tāte bhāla kari' śloka karaha vicāra
 - kavi kahe,--ye kahile sei veda-sāra
 
SYNONYMS
tāte—therefore; bhāla—very carefully; kari'-doing it; śloka—the verse; karaha—do; vicāra—judgment; kavi kahe—the poet said; ye kahile—what You have said; sei—that is; veda-sāra—exactly right.
TRANSLATION
The Lord concluded, "Now, therefore, let us carefully scrutinize this verse." The poet replied, "Yes, the verse You have recited is perfectly correct.
